Abstract

Applied anatomy of the pancreas, stem cells, secretion of bile and pancreatic secretions, and their feedback control mechanisms have been outlined. Pathogenesis and management of key clinical topics like gallstones, biliary malignancy, and indeterminate biliary stricture have been discussed. Revised Atlanta classification of acute pancreatitis, recent advances in the management of peripancreatic collections, walled-off pancreatic necrosis (WOPN), and pancreatic malignancy are discussed. This section includes Indian data on chronic pancreatitis and genetics. The role of pancreatic functional testing and the role of pancreatic enzyme supplements have been discussed.
